Dynamically induced Planck scale and inflation in the Palatini formulation
Ioannis D. Gialamas🇬🇷 · Alexandros Karam🇪🇪 · Antonio Racioppi🇪🇪
Abstract
We study non-minimal Coleman-Weinberg inflation in the Palatini formulation of gravity in the presence of an term. The Planck scale is dynamically generated by the vacuum expectation value of the inflaton via its non-minimal coupling to the curvature scalar . We show that the addition of the term in Palatini gravity makes non-minimal Coleman-Weinberg inflation again compatible with observational data.
